def quicksort(tarr):
"""
Input must be a enumerated list with the index in [0] and value in [1]
"""
if len(tarr) <= 1:
return tarr
else:
l, pivot, r = partition(tarr)
return quicksort(l)+[pivot]+quicksort(r)
def partition(tarr):
pivot, tarr = tarr[len(tarr)-1], tarr[:len(tarr)-1]
l = [x for x in tarr if x[1] <= pivot[1]]
r = [x for x in tarr if x[1] > pivot[1]]
return l, pivot, r
